Hope I’m in the correct thread. I was a scanner guy years ago whn their banks frequencies and talk ids.Trying the Whistler 1080 out and I’m having a crazy time programming Tampa fl Hillsborough county sheriff department as East and west and in two separate scan list. Each time I do this I program through ezscan East in scanlist 01 works perfect yet once I program West next into scanlist 02 then East goes completely quiet. I’ve been trying different methods for 2 weeks now. No luck! Anyone know what I could be missing here? Thank you someone?

Sounds like you are trying to program the system twice. You can only put each system in once through the Library Import. Couple of options, one is program the Talkgroups for EAST and WEST into two scanlists, second manually enter (suggest using duplicate on right side of EZ Scan System tab) the system/sites make original one and duplicate another.

UPDATE: Looking at the system, you will need to use option 2 since the EAST/WEST are sites not TGs. Keep in mind any future changes through library import will only be done on the original system, you must manually add TGs in the duplicate system.
